Cintas Named One of the World’s Most Trustworthy Companies by Newsweek

This marks Cintas’ debut on the list and reaffirms the trust that customers, employee-partners, and shareholders place in the company.

CINCINNATI--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Cintas Corporation (Nasdaq: CTAS) has been named to Newsweek’s list of World’s Most Trustworthy Companies 2025. This marks Cintas’ first appearance on this list and further demonstrates its commitment to earning the trust and confidence of customers, employee-partners, and shareholders.

“Trust and integrity are core elements of our company’s culture and, as a result, how we run our operations,” said Todd Schneider, Cintas President and CEO. “That’s why customers choose Cintas. They trust us to show up, to do the job right and care about their business like it’s our own. It’s an honor to receive this recognition, and we remain committed to upholding this standard.”

This prestigious award is presented by Newsweek in collaboration with Statista. The list was identified based on a detailed methodology that included: ​​​​​

  • A review of public companies with revenues of over $500 million in 20 countries
  • An extensive survey of over 65,000 respondents in 20 countries who evaluated companies on three dimensions of trust:
    • Customer Trust, Investor Trust, Employee Trust
  • A review of over 500,000 public mentions about the companies, scored in four areas:
    • Number of Mentions, Sentiment, Virality, and Reach.

About Cintas Corporation

Cintas Corporation helps more than one million businesses of all types and sizes get Ready™ to open their doors with confidence every day by providing products and services that help keep their customers’ facilities and employees clean, safe, and looking their best. With offerings including uniforms, mats, mops, towels, restroom supplies, workplace water services, first aid and safety products, eye-wash stations, safety training, fire extinguishers, sprinkler systems and alarm service, Cintas helps customers get Ready for the Workday®. Headquartered in Cincinnati, Cintas is a publicly held Fortune 500 company traded over the Nasdaq Global Select Market under the symbol CTAS and is a component of both the Standard & Poor’s 500 Index and Nasdaq-100 Index.
